Teaching classical Pilates in a trend-driven industry with Amy Kellow
from Beyond the Reformer · host Nic Lenny
Today, Nic is joined by Amy Kellow, founder of Everybody Pilates, second-generation teacher, and educator with studios across the UK and the Netherlands.They talk about what classical Pilates really means, how to balance structure with intuition, and why understanding the origins of the work is essential, no matter what style you teach.Amy explores the challenges of scaling a Pilates business, managing a team across locations, and how to keep evolving as a teacher while staying rooted in the original system.Timestamps:00:00 Amy’s first encounter with Pilates and how it helped her back pain02:13 Teaching her first classes in local leisure centres and village halls03:19 Training in the full classical system05:37 What classical Pilates really is and how it’s often misunderstood10:14 Classical vs contemporary Pilates14:14 Amy’s first meeting with Jay Grimes and what she learned from him16:30 Stories from Joseph Pilates19:24 Developing her own training programme and the role of intuition in teaching24:05 Changes Amy sees in Pilates clients29:31 Growing Everybody Pilates to four studios, including one in the Netherlands31:17 Maintaining quality and ethos across multiple locations34:29 Leading a team and looking after your teachers37:42 Future plans for expanding education and opening more studios39:15 The pressure to modernise with trends43:33 How Amy balances studio life, teaching, and curriculum development48:07 The importance of staying inspired, asking questions, and being curious53:58 Quick fire questions- advice from Jay, biggest influences, and the gift Pilates has given AmyThanks for listening to this weeks episode!
